2008 Book Drive 

 

Book Donations for a Children's Charity 

 

 

 

As part of the holiday festivities at the SLA Philadelphia Holiday Party, a children's  charity is selected to receive book donations from SLA members. 

 

The selected charity for this year's book drive is the Lubuto Library Project The not-for-profit Lubuto Library Project was founded by SLA member, Jane Meyers, from the Washington DC Chapter with the goal of bringing libraries to the AIDS orphans in Zambia, Southern Africa.  Wrapping books is not necessary, because the books will be classified and added to a Lubuto collection, not given to an individual child.  Please take a look at Lubuto's book donation guidelines before selecting your new or gently-used book to donate.

Lubuto is a word in the Bemba language, spoken in central Africa, that signifies knowledge, enlightenment and light.
